14. Rachelle hangs up posters to find a missing dog, Cooper. Each poster is hung four feet below the top of the streetlights around the neighborhood. The angle formed by the ladder and the streetlight is 55°. If a taller ladder was to reach the top of the streetlight, the angle formed where they meet would be 40°. Approximately how far are the posters from the bottom of each streetlight? 5.7 feet 7.6 feet 4.7 feet 9.9 feet
